React je populární JavaScript knihovna pro tvorbu uživatelského rozhraní. Jednou z klíčových funkcí Reactu je možnost vytvářet opakovaně použitelné komponenty, které mohou obsahovat jakýkoliv uživatelský prvek, jako jsou tlačítka, formuláře nebo seznamy.
Jednou z důležitých funkcí Reactu je schopnost vytvářet sestavy, které jsou složeny z více komponent. Tyto sestavy umožňují organizovat a strukturovat kód tak, aby byl snadno čitelný a udržovatelný.
Vytváření sestav pomocí Reactu se obvykle provádí pomocí funkcionálního přístupu. To znamená, že každá sestava je samostatná funkce, která obsahuje jednotlivé komponenty a definuje jejich propojení a chování.
Při vytváření sestav je důležité myslet na to, jaké komponenty budou třeba a jak budou spolu interagovat. Je také důležité správně organizovat kód a oddělit různé logické části sestavy do samostatných komponent.
Při vytváření sestav je důležité mít na paměti také zásady znovupoužitelnosti a jednoduchosti kódu. Sestavy by měly být navrženy tak, aby bylo možné je snadno znovu použít v jiných částech aplikace nebo dokonce v jiných projektech.
React nabízí mnoho užitečných nástrojů a funkcí pro vytváření sestav, jako jsou contexty, hooky nebo portály. Tyto funkce umožňují velmi flexibilní a výkonné možnosti vytváření sestav a tvorby uživatelského rozhraní.
Vytváření sestav pomocí Reactu je tedy velmi důležitý prvek při tvorbě moderních webových aplikací. Správné vytváření sestav může znamenat rozdíl mezi dobře organizovanou a udržovatelnou aplikací a chaotickým a těžko spravovatelným kódem. S Reactem je možné vytvořit efektivní a elegantní řešení pro tvorbu uživatelského rozhraní, které bude snadno rozšiřitelné a snadno upravitelné.